The Fish Health industry is rapidly growing, and there's a significant demand for professionals specializing in fish health and aquaculture. This 3D Pie chart highlights the top five roles in fish health with their respective job market percentages in the UK. 1. Fish Health Manager: Fish Health Managers play a critical role in maintaining healthy fish populations, monitoring disease outbreaks, and implementing biosecurity measures. This role is in high demand, with a 25% share of the fish health job market. 2. Aquaculture Veterinarian: Aquaculture Veterinarians are responsible for diagnosing and treating diseases in fish, as well as providing guidance on fish health management. Demand for this role is strong, with a 20% share of the fish health job market. 3. Fish Nutritionist: Fish Nutritionists specialize in creating balanced diets for fish, ensuring optimal growth and health. With a 15% share of the fish health job market, this role is essential for sustainable aquaculture practices. 4. Fish Pathologist: Fish Pathologists study fish diseases and develop strategies to prevent and control outbreaks. This role accounts for 18% of the fish health job market, making it a vital component of the industry. 5. Fish Farming Consultant: Fish Farming Consultants provide expert advice on fish farming operations, including equipment selection, production optimization, and environmental management. This role represents 22% of the fish health job market and offers excellent career growth potential. As the aquaculture sector expands, so does the demand for skilled professionals in fish health.
